Overview:
This course is intended for students who wish to gain the foundational understanding of Microsoft Office Excel that is necessary to create and work with electronic spreadsheets.
Course Objectives
In this course, you will learn to:
- Perform calculations
- Modify a worksheet
- Format a workbook
- Print workbooks
- Manage Workbooks

Course Outline
Lesson 1: Basic Excel Usage
- Navigating the Excel Interface
- Using Excel Commands
- Creating and Saving a Basic Workbook
- Entering Cell Data
- Using Excel Help
Lesson 2: Performing Calculations
- Creating Worksheet Formulas
- Inserting Functions
- Reusing Formulas and Functions
Lesson 3: Modifying a Worksheet
- Inserting, Deleting and Adjusting Cells, Columns and Rows
- Searching for and Replacing Data
- Using Proofing and Research Tools
Lesson 4: Formatting a Worksheet
- Applying Text Formats
- Applying Number Formats
- Aligning Cell Contents
- Applying Styles and Themes
- Applying Basic Conditional Formatting
- Creating and Using Templates
Lesson 5: Printing Workbooks
- Previewing and Printing a Workbook
- Setting up the Page Layout
- Configuring Headers and Footers
Lesson 6: Managing Workbooks
- Managing Worksheets
- Managing Worksheet and Workbook Views
- Managing Workbook Properties
